Calais

Calais is a major port city in northern France and the closest French town to England, overlooking the Strait of Dover. Historically significant as a trading hub and under English control for over two centuries, it retains unique architectural heritage. The city is divided into the historic Calais-Nord, situated on an artificial island surrounded by canals, and the modern St-Pierre district to the south. As a primary transport node for ferries and the Channel Tunnel, it serves millions of travelers annually. For hotel guests, staying here offers easy access to cross-channel connections while exploring landmarks like the Tour du Guet and Notre-Dame Church.

Where to Base: Old vs. New Town

For a historic experience, base yourself in Calais-Nord, the old town located on an artificial island. This area surrounds the Place d'Armes, featuring the 13th-century Tour du Guet and the unique English-style Notre-Dame Church. It offers a charming, walkable environment rich in heritage. Alternatively, the St-Pierre district to the south provides a more modern setting with easier access to contemporary amenities and transport links to the ferry terminals and Channel Tunnel.

Getting Around: Cross-Channel Hub

Calais serves as a critical transport hub for travelers moving between France and the UK. The city is a major port for ferries and connects to Folkestone via the Channel Tunnel, which has operated since 1994. On a clear day, the White Cliffs of Dover are visible from Calais. The compact nature of the old town makes it highly walkable for sightseeing, while the broader urban area facilitates easy access to ports and rail stations for onward journeys.

Histoire Ancienne

RestaurantBib Gourmand€€586 m

This bistro nurtures its authentic vintage look, courtesy of banquette seating, mirrors and Art deco-style posters. Patrick Comte is at the helm, rolling out his tasty take on traditional seasonal dishes: snail persillade; egg bourguignonne and a buttery golden turnip; Angus faux-filet steak, gratin dauphinois with maroilles and béarnaise sauce; a Paris-Brest-style éclair with hazelnut ice cream… Indulgent cooking that hits the spot every time!

Le Grand Bleu

Restaurant€€1.2 km

The chef, Matthieu Colin, puts the experience he gained in Michelin-starred establishments to good use. In a lovely contemporary interior, he continues to pay tribute to local fishing, but also brings local produce into creative dishes that thrive on originality: cod with seafood condiments, grapefruit, crozets, spiced fennel. Friendly and efficient service.

Aquar'aile

Restaurant€€1.8 km

This pleasant top-floor restaurant boasts a peerless panoramic view over the Strait of Dover and the English coast… it is like something you would expect to see in a painting! The food showcases locally caught fish: lobster casserole, sea bass in a salt crust, sole meunière. To be washed down with a good wine chosen from a list carefully curated by the proprietor.
